How Thermal Sleeves Solve the Energy Storage Puzzle

Enter thermal sleeves – these multilayer polymer composites act like a climate control system for individual battery cells. Unlike traditional cooling methods that address entire battery racks, sleeves provide targeted thermal management at the cellular level.

Three Key Functions of High-Performance Sleeves

  1. Isolate heat during rapid charging/discharging cycles
  2. Maintain temperature differentials below 5°C across battery modules
  3. Prevent thermal runaway propagation between adjacent cells

Wait, no – that third point needs clarification. Actually, premium thermal sleeves combine phase-change materials with aerogel insulation to achieve both thermal regulation and fire resistance.
